The image illustrates three English idioms with cartoon-style visuals: a man physically stretching a dollar bill to represent frugality; a cheerful clam in a top hat and cane symbolizing contentment; and Lady Justice holding balanced scales and a sword, embodying fairness and legal integrity. Each depiction highlights how figurative language draws from concrete imagery to convey abstract ideas. The educational layout is designed for language learners and teachers.
